Assington is a village in , England, 4 miles south-east of . At the 2011 Census it had a population of 402, estimated at 445 in 2019. The parish includes the hamlets of Rose Green and Dorking Tye.

The is a facility for telecommunications and broadcasting transmission at , . It consists of two guyed masts, one, the original, being 165.8 metres high, and a second mast at 103 metres.
